How to Protect Your Personal and Financial Information Online
Many online gamblers neglect the importance of securing their financial and personal information, which can lead to dire consequences. To minimize potential threats, individuals should use strong, unique passwords for their gaming accounts and rotate them on a consistent basis. Utilizing two-factor authentication introduces a further safeguard, making it harder for unauthorized users to gain access.
Moreover, participants ought to be careful about providing sensitive details. Credible online gaming sites will never ask for private details through unsafe communication channels. Regularly monitoring banking records for suspicious activity is crucial; such inconsistencies must be flagged without delay.
Employing secure payment methods, including e-wallets or prepaid cards, can help safeguard sensitive financial information. Making sure that the device used for gaming is equipped with updated antivirus software also minimizes exposure to malware and phishing threats. By implementing these practices, online gamblers can greatly enhance their data security and enjoy a safer gaming experience.

Licensing and Regulation
Although numerous online casinos offer thrilling gameplay and attractive bonuses, the most vital factor in choosing a safe platform lies in its licensing and regulation. A credible online casino needs to be certified by an established regulatory authority, such as the Malta Gaming Authority or the UK Gambling Commission. Such organizations ensure that casinos comply with rigorous fairness and security requirements. Players are advised to confirm the casino's license details, typically displayed at the bottom of the main page. Additionally, regulatory compliance often includes regular audits and player protection measures. Participating in an unlicensed casino puts players at risk of encountering unethical behavior and inadequate data protection. Therefore, verifying the licensing and regulatory standing of an online casino is crucial for a secure gaming environment.

Game Fairness Guarantee
Guaranteeing fair gameplay is vital for players looking for a secure online gaming experience. Trusted online casino platforms employ Random Number Generators (RNGs) to verify that gaming results remain fair and random. Players are encouraged to find casinos that are subject to routine inspections by external auditing bodies, such as eCOGRA or iTech Labs, which validate the reliability of game outcomes. Additionally, transparent payout percentages are fundamental; casinos should readily provide their Return to Player (RTP) rates. This information allows players to make informed choices. Choosing casinos with licenses from recognized regulatory bodies additionally builds confidence, as these regulators maintain high standards of integrity. By considering these factors, players can significantly minimize the likelihood of experiencing biased gameplay.
Recognize and Steer Clear of Frequent Scams
Detecting and preventing common scams is critical for players exploring the online casino landscape. A wide range of fraudulent tactics target unaware players, making vigilance a primary defense. A prevalent scam involves phishing emails that are designed to look like they come from legitimate casinos, prompting users to disclose personal information. Players should consistently confirm the legitimacy of any communication by reaching out to the casino via official channels.
A further widespread approach is fake websites that mimic trusted platforms, frequently attracting players with exaggerated bonuses. To protect yourself from such threats, people must confirm they are using protected, authorized platforms. Additionally, scams may involve unauthorized payment methods or requests for deposits in copyright without proper security measures.
Familiarizing yourself about red flags—such as uninvited proposals or implausible deals—can notably reduce the risk of falling prey to these deceptive practices. By staying alert and conducting thorough research, players can safeguard their interests in the online gaming environment.

Can a VPN Be Used for Safer Online Gambling?
Employing a VPN for online casino gaming can strengthen privacy and security by masking the user's IP address. That said, a number of online casinos may ban VPN usage, possibly causing account limitations or bans when detected.

What Are the Ways to Verify Casino Game Fairness?
To verify casino game fairness, individuals should check for approvals from well-known licensing authorities, examine independent verification reports, and search for endorsements from trusted groups like eCOGRA, confirming that games employ random number generators to produce fair results.
